Transaction 8684add8de871dd05c8ca844ecc67c344a854baadb6df508407d0c328f30529e
1 Input
1 Output
-
8684add8de871dd05c8ca844ecc67c344a854baadb6df508407d0c328f30529e:0
- value
- 2862073
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1887f177e665377b570b5b182bdca56faecc767c OP_EQUAL
- address
- 33vizecVCniHEpCGK7G4rM124qsbjyA9gv